**v3.8.2 — Setting renamed**

The websocket reconnect bug in Wirelark was traced to the old `WS_RETRY_KEY` setting, which clients silently ignored after the 3.7 refactor. It has been renamed to `RECONNECT_AUTH_TOKEN` and is now mandatory; reconnect attempts fail closed without it. When rolling a node, update its env file so it contains the following line.

sealed setting: VAULT_KEY20=69e2a0b23f1a79fbf692

Subject: Key rotation for InvoiceForge renderer

Welcome, new folks. Every quarter we rotate the credential the Pellworth PDF invoice renderer uses to call our internal asset service, Vaultline. The old key stops working Friday at noon. Update your local .env and the staging config before then, and verify a test invoice renders with the new embedded fonts. For convenience, the freshly issued key is included here.

app token of bagef-bageg = kto11_vuwA0uhrEMg

Ticket: Parcel-tracking webhook for Swiftcrate retries indefinitely on 410 responses, flooding the Dunmore queue. Fix caps retries at five with exponential backoff and dead-letters the payload. Tests cover the 410, 429, and timeout paths. Ready for review; merge is blocked pending sign-off from the service owner named below.

approver of tagef-hawef = Oliok Julath

Ticket for security review: the DedupeDesk on-call alert deduplicator in staging was deployed with an incomplete env file, causing duplicate pages overnight. Root cause: the suppression-store connection lacked its auth credential, so writes silently failed. Remediation is a one-line fix; the credential should be inserted directly after this sentence in staging's .env.

vault entry, yahif-yajep: COURIER_KEY29=b802bdf8034096b65a51c6ba5abe2

When downstream consumers fall behind, the dispatcher shrinks its delivery window and defers low-priority batches rather than dropping them. Your plugin's delivery callback must return promptly; slow callbacks are counted against your plugin's quota and can trigger throttling for your channel alone. These behaviors are tunable per deployment, and operators are expected to review them before enabling third-party plugins. The relevant settings are reproduced below.

config for yajep-tafof:
[rusath]
team = julmir
access_code = ac_fe37fd
host = rusath.novactech.test
port = 8000
owner = pelmir.weneth
peer = oliwyn.olvarqdyn.internal